The Incident: What Happened?
Fire Erupts on the Tarmac
Denver airport The American Airlines flight was preparing for departure at Denver International Airport when passengers and ground personnel noticed smoke and flames coming from one of the aircraft’s engines. Witnesses described hearing a loud noise before the fire erupted, sending plumes of smoke into the air.
- Immediate Shock and Panic: Passengers onboard the aircraft reported feeling an unusual vibration before seeing smoke outside the windows.
- Rapid Crew Response: The flight crew acted swiftly, notifying air traffic control and initiating emergency procedures.
- Passengers Remain Calm but Concerned: While there Denver airport was initial confusion, the flight attendants ensured that panic was kept to a minimum.
Emergency Response and Evacuation
Airport emergency services were on the scene within minutes, using specialized fire suppression equipment to extinguish the flames.
- Firefighting Efforts: Crews deployed foam and water to control the fire before it could spread further.
- Evacuation Procedures: Passengers were evacuated as a precautionary measure, using emergency exits to safely deplane.
- Medical Checks: While there were no severe injuries, some passengers required minor medical attention for smoke inhalation.
Investigating the Cause of the Fire
Authorities, including the Federal Aviation Administration (FAA) and the National Transportation Safety Board (NTSB), have launched an investigation into what led to the fire. Several possible causes are being considered:
Engine Malfunction
One of the primary theories being examined is a mechanical failure in the aircraft’s engine.
- Turbine Failure: If internal engine components, such as the turbine blades, were damaged or worn out, it could have resulted in overheating and ignition.
- Fuel Line Issues: A leak or rupture in the fuel line may have led to the release of flammable liquid near high-temperature areas.
Brake Overheating
If the fire originated near the landing gear, overheated brakes may have been the culprit.
- Excessive Friction: When brakes are applied too aggressively or fail to cool properly, the heat can ignite hydraulic fluids.
- Lack of Cooling Time: The aircraft’s recent operation history will be reviewed to determine if adequate cooling time was given between flights.
External Factors
While mechanical issues are a strong possibility, external factors cannot be ruled out.
- Bird Strike: If a bird was ingested into the engine during taxiing, it could have caused internal damage, leading to the fire.
- Foreign Object Damage: Debris on the tarmac or runway could have impacted a sensitive part of the aircraft.
